=pod

=head1 NAME

Apache2::ASP::ConfigNode::System - the 'system' portion of the config.

=head1 SYNOPSIS

  my $system = $Config->system;

=head1 DESCRIPTION

This package provides special access to the elements specific to the C<system>
portion of the XML config file.

=head1 PUBLIC PROPERTIES

=head2 libs

A list of library paths that should be included into C<@INC>.

=head2 load_modules

A list of Perl modules that should be loaded automatically.

=head2 post_processors

A list of L<Apache2::ASP::ConfigPostProcessor> modules that should be given the ability to alter the config before
it is considered "ready for use" by the rest of the application.

=head2 env_vars

A hash of C<%ENV> variables that should be set.

=head2 settings

A collection of special read-only values that should be available throughout the application.

Examples include encryption keys, API keys and username/password combos to access remote services.
